Tungsten is a metallic element, the chemical symbol is W. Atomic number is 74, relative atomic mass is 183.85, atomic radius for 137pm, and density is 19.35 g/cm?.

Production Process:
Reducing tungsten trioxide or ammonium paratungstate by hydrogen reduction furnace (electric furnace of rotary furnace).
The process of hydrogen reduction of tungsten powder needs two steps:
- The first step in 500~700℃ and reducing WO3 to WO2;
- The second step in 700~900℃,Reducing WO2 to tungsten powder.
